1. Chocolate Chip Cookies: For the Dreamers
Chocolate chip cookies are the quintessential treat for anyone who dares to dream big. Their warm, gooey centers and crispy edges symbolize the comfort of chasing after your dreams while staying grounded.
Ingredients:
- 2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 cup unsalted butter, at room temperature
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1 cup packed br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 2 large eggs
- 2 cups semisweet chocolate chips
Instructions: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a small bowl, whisk together the flour and baking soda; set aside.
- In a large bowl, cream together the butter, granulated sugar, brown sugar, and salt until smooth.
- Add vanilla and eggs; beat until well combined.
- Gradually blend in the flour mixture.
- Stir in the chocolate chips.
- Drop by large spoonfuls onto ungreased pans.
- Bake for 9 to 11 minutes or until golden brown. Let cool on wire racks.
2. Dreamy Vanilla Cupcakes: For the Achievers
Vanilla cupcakes represent the sweet success that comes from hard work and dedication. Their fluffy texture and delightful frosting remind us that every achievement, big or small, deserves a celebration.
Ingredients:
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 large eggs
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 3/4 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
Instructions: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with cupcake liners.
- In a b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ition, then stir in the vanilla.
- In another bowl, mix the flour, baking powder, and salt.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, alternating with the milk. Stir until just combined.
- Fill the cupcake liners about two-thirds full and bake for 18 to 20 minutes. Allow to cool before frosting.
3. Lemon Bars: For the Innovators
Lemon bars are a perfect treat for those who think outside the box. Their zesty flavor and vibrant color symbolize innovation and creativity, encouraging you to explore new ideas and methods.
Ingredients:
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up powdered sugar
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 large eggs
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1/2 cup fresh l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
Instructions: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ease an 8-inch square baking dish.
- In a bowl, combine flour, powdered sugar, and butter until crumbly.
- Press the mixture into the bottom of the prepared dish and bake for 15 minutes.
- In another bowl, whisk together the eggs, granulated sugar, lemon juice, lemon zest, and salt.
- Pour the lemon mixture over the baked crust and return to the oven for an additional 20 minutes.
- Allow to cool, then dust with powdered sugar before serving.
4. Red Velvet Cake: For the Passionate
Red velvet cake is a classic symbol of passion and love. Its rich color and decadent flavor capture the essence of pursuing your deepest desires with fervor and commitment.
Ingredients:
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on cocoa powder
- 1 cup vegetable oil
- 1 cup buttermilk, room temperature
- 2 large eggs
- 2 tablespoons red food coloring
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on white vinegar
Instructions: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ease and flour two round cake pans.
- In a bowl, sift together flour, sugar, baking soda, salt, and cocoa powder.
- In another bowl, mix the oil, buttermilk, eggs, food coloring, vanilla, and vinegar.
- Combine the wet and dry ingredients, mixing until just combined.
- Pour the batter evenly into the prepared pans and bake for 25 to 30 minutes. Allow to cool before frosting with cream cheese frosting.
